      Yes, I can help! You can either connect the phone directly, or purchase either Apple Airport Express, Google Chromecast Audio, Audiocast M5, Tibo Bond Mini or any Bluetooth receiver for wireless music from your phone to the B&O system (sorry I don't sell these devices, only the cables!)
      This cable will allow you to connect any of the devices listed above to the Aux socket on the back of your B&O system:-
      ‪soundsheavenly.com/bang-olufsen/67-298-minijack-to-aux-in-ipod-to-beosound-beomaster-beocenter-using-aux-din-socket.html#/2-length-1m‬
      Please set the phone volume to maximum when connecting to the B&O system - this is normal when using a portable music player with a home audio system due to the low output levels produced by the phone.
      To listen to the music, simply press "A.Aux" on the B&O keypad, or select this on the B&O remote control by pressing the "LIST" button until the display shows "A.AUX", then pressing "GO".

    Steve, Having just bought one of these back from a friend, to replace a BeoSound/Master 5, I really appreciate what you're talking about. However, having sold dozens of these units when new from our store here in Denver, I would always use the AUX as an output for non-powerlink setups simply because you never need to worry about the volume issue if you're using another preamp. And you're not "using up" the AUX port if you only hookup the Output side, leaving the Input side completely free for other sources. I was at the world premier for the BS9000 in Paris at the US dealer meeting in 1995. It was a very exciting time.

      Thank you! Please note that you cannot cast music wirelessly from a Beosound to speaker using any of these devices, they are for sending music from your phone to the Beosound instead. The only wireless option that actually works to link these speakers to the Beosound is the B&O Transmitter 1/Receiver 1 system which you would need to buy directly from B&O. Cheaper options like Bluetooth won't work here, so I don't support them. Please let me know if you decide to buy the correct wireless system from B&O and I can help with cables.

    • @soundsheavenly
      @soundsheavenly  Рік тому +3

      Hi, yes you can use just the S/PDIF digital output if you have a separate DAC (digital to analogue converter) then you can use the Beosound 9000 as just a CD transport. You still need the Speaker Sense Adapter mentioned in the video if you want to be able to remote control the 9000 and you won't get Radio or Aux signals this way, only CDs.

      Later Beogram models with a pre amp built in can connect directly to the 9000. However, as the Beogram 4002 doesn’t have a pre-amp, you will need this pre-amp kit instead, which comes with all cables needed and full instructions, ready to “plug and play”:-
      soundsheavenly.com/beogram-record-players/12-2196-pre-amp-bundle-for-bo-beogram-and-all-turntables.html#/36-output-5_pin_din_aux/41-power_supply-uk

    • @MikaSyrenius
      @MikaSyrenius 10 місяців тому +1

      @@soundsheavenly Ok. Thank you! So, basically the main (and only) advantage of connecting Beogram to Beosound is simply to pass through the audio to same speakers without any other external switch.

    • @soundsheavenly
      @soundsheavenly  10 місяців тому +1

      @@MikaSyrenius Hi, no that is not always correct. You cannot connect a Beogram turntable directly to Beolab speakers as there is no way to control the volume. Connecting via the Beosound makes this connection possible, you need the volume control on the Beosound or you cannot make the connection to the Beogram. Your setup is a special case if you are using the A9 as this has a volume control, but this is not the case for most Beolab speakers.
